The paramount merger, a $111 billion acquisition of Warner Bros. Discovery, has been delayed after a court loss. Paramount Skydance agreed to a longer-term delay, preventing the companies from combining until after a judge rules on the merits of the case. This delay is a significant development in the ongoing saga of the paramount merger.
The states and companies agreed that the merger will not be completed and the firms will not integrate their operations until five days after the merits determination in these matters, or on June 1, 2027, whichever is earlier. This delay was also agreed to by the Writers Guild of America, which filed its own lawsuit to block the merger.
